“…A key regulator of the anb3 integrin is the transcription factor, HOXA10 (Daftary et al, 2002), which is also reduced in mild endometriosis (Szczepanska et al, 2010). Letrozole treatment has been shown to increase anb3 expression, compared with clomiphene citrate in the rat uterus model (Bao et al, 2009). The increase in integrin expression in response to letrozole in natural cycles, reflects the improved implantation and pregnancy rates noted during IVF in patients who took letrozole.…”

“…We think that letrozole resulted in comparable pregnancy rate as clomiphene citrate, in spite of less number of mature oocytes induced, because it has no adverse effect on endometrium. Boa et al found that the markers of endometrial receptivity (HOXA10 and integrin alpha (v) beta (3)) in rats were suppressed by clomiphene citrate and not affected by letrozole [24]. Moreover, Cortinez reported that letrozole administration in infertile ovulatory women was associated with in-phase histological dating of endometrium and normal pinopode expression [10].…”

“…A recent study in a rat model suggests that ovarian stimulation with CC has a suppressive effect on integrin and HOXA10 expression, when compared to letrozole [Bao et al 2009]. In addition to the molecular markers, fully developed pinopods were also observed to be maximally expressed in unexplained infertile women stimulated with letrozole ( Figure 1).…”
